Titans Hit Wall in Pursuit of Proteas Teen Star Nqobani Mokoena

The Centurion-based Titans are after the Proteas' newly found star, teenage fast bowling sensation Nqobani Mokoena, looking to bring the 19-year-old up to the Highveld from the coastal domestic team, the Dolphins.

What has Mokoena done?

Mokoena has taken the world by storm this season, with the right-arm fast bowler impressing many with sheer pace and skill. 

His most impressive stint this season has been with the Paarl Royals, where, playing alongside Proteas star and Paarl Royals captain David Miller, he managed to pick up 13 wickets in the tournament. 

The youngster also showcased his tenacity and hunger for high-pressure moments when Miller handed him the ball during the first power play of the game and during the death overs of the match. 

Despite playing against some of the world's best batters in the SA20, Mokoena still delivered, a feat that saw him get his maiden international call-up for the ongoing five-match T20I series against New Zealand in New Zealand. 

The youngster has played three matches thus far, taking a three-for on his debut, winning the Player of the Match award in his maiden international fixture. 

Transfer News

Because of the promise that the youngster has shown, SportsBoom.co.za has learned that one of South Africa's most successful teams, the Titans, has shown interest in securing his signature. 

However, it will be a mission to secure the youngster's signature, given that his current team, the Dolphins, have shown a lot of faith in his talents and handed him his first big break. 

Dolphins head coach Quinton Friend was a fast bowler during his playing days and seems to have created a very healthy environment for up-and-coming fast bowlers over in Durban, as he has the likes of Okuhle Cele and Eathan Bosch in his ranks. 

For a youngster such as Mokoena, the Dolphins' environment could be just what he needs for his development. 

As a result, SportsBoom understands that the Titans have hit a brick wall in their pursuit of the youngster, as the young fast bowler seems adamant to remain in Durban and repay the faith shown to him by Friend and the entire Dolphins coaching staff.
